Complete Guide to Hiring Laravel Developers: Tips and Best Practices


Introduction
In the dynamic world of network development, it is necessary and challenging to find talented Laravel developers. A popular PHP network has been observed for frameworks, Laravel, its pure syntax, powerful features and strong developer communities. Leasing the right Laravel developers is important to secure the success of your web projects.
In this comprehensive manual, we can pressure you through the process of hiring Laravel developers, who will cover the entirety from defining their necessities to successfully comparing candidates.
Why Laravel Is the Go-To Framework for Modern Web Development
Introduction to Laravel and Its Popularity
An elegant and powerful PHP structure, Laravel has greatly affected the net development with its expressive syntax and strong properties. The extensive popularity comes from the opportunity to streamline general network development features such as authentication, routing and improving cache, so developers can focus on creating unique application features. This efficiency makes it a preferred alternative to companies and developers, which continuously improves the demand for skilled Laravel professionals.
Benefits of Using Laravel for Scalable Projects
Laravel provides many benefits, making it an excellent choice to create scalable and maintenance web applications:
MVC Architecture:Its Model-Vs-Controller (MVC) Architectural patterns sell prepared, modular and reformulated code to simplify the manipulation and scaling of architectural styles and complex projects.
Built-in Features: Laravel comes tool without-of-the-field functionalities like authentication, authorization, and API support, substantially accelerating development time.
Enhanced Security: It gives sturdy security facilities along with SQL injection, Cross-Site Request Founder (CSRF) and protection against Cross-Site Scripting (XSS), which guarantees information integrity and user safety.
Artisan CLI: Powerful command line interface (CLI), Artisan, Database Migration and Code Generation automates repetitive capabilities, promotes the developer's productivity.
Vast Ecosystem and Community: Laravel boasts a huge and lively network, offering sizable documentation, tutorials, and a wealth of organized-to-use applications, which simplifies development and troubleshooting.
Modern Trends Compatibility: Laravel is continuously evolving to help cutting-edge development tendencies like microservices shape, serverless deployments (through Laravel Vapor), AI integration, real-time packages (with Laravel Echo and WebSockets), and headless CMS setups.
Why Businesses Prefer to Hire Laravel Developers
Businesses frequently pick to hire Laravel developers because of the framework's performance, safety, and scalability. Laravel enables quicker improvement cycles, thereby lowering the time-to-market for emblem spanking new applications. Its easy code and well-defined architectural styles result in less difficult upkeep and destiny improvements, offering a robust return on funding. Furthermore, the lively community useful resource ensures that builders can speedy find out answers and cling to great practices, further streamlining project execution.
When Should You Hire a Laravel Developer?
Signs You Need a Dedicated Laravel Developer
If you understand any of the following signs, you can need to hire a Laravel developer
Increasing Project Complexity: Your present day team is suffering to deal with the growing complexity of your web utility.
Slow Development Pace: The growth cycles are increased, and the rollout of new functions is dull.
Performance Issues: Your current application met the hedges or challenges of scalability.
Security Concerns: You need increased security measures and comply with modern security standards online.
Lack of Specialized Expertise: Your in-house team lacks specific larval knowledge or experience with advanced functions such as larvae Octane or integrated AI/ML.
Project Types Ideal for Laravel Development
The versatility of the laravel is suitable for a wide range of projects, including:
Custom Web Applications: Construction of unique business equipment, CRM or ERP that fits specific requirements.
E-commerce Platforms: Development of scalable online stores with strong payment ports and complex product management.
Content Management Systems (CMS): Flexible production, user-friendly and easy to manage material platforms including headless CMS implementation.
APIs and Backend Services: Mobile applications, applications with one-position (SPA) and powerful backing crafts for third-party integration.
SaaS Applications: Develop software program-e-service answers with multi-tarm-e-provider that require high scalability and strong user management.
In-House vs. Outsourced Laravel Development
When considering how to hire Laravel developers, you mainly have two strategic options:
In-House Development:This involves hiring full -time employees to work directly in your organization. It provides high control and direct communication, but often comes with high overhead costs (salaries, profits, office space) and can be a slow process of recruitment.
Outsourced Development: IT forces partnership with external experts or agencies.The options include hiring freelancers, operating with a committed improvement agency or deciding on an offshore team. Outsourcing provides flexibility, get right of entry to to a global abilities pool, and regularly provides extensive fee financial savings.
How to Hire Laravel Developers: A Step-by-Step Process
Define Your Project Requirements Clearly
It is important to define your project well before you go ahead to hire the laravel developers in India talent. It also includes:
Project Goals and Objectives: Clearly explain what you want to achieve with the application.
Key Features and Functionalities: List all the necessary features and desired user streams.
Technical Specifications: preferred technical stacks, essential integration (eg payment port, external API), and expanded expectations of performance.
Timeline and Budget: Establish realistic time constraints and benefit from the right financial resources. A clear scope of the project will largely help to identify proper developers with accurate skills and necessary experience.
Decide Between Hiring Freelancers, Agencies, or Offshore Teams
The alternative between these models depends on the scope of the project, budget and desired control level:
Freelancers: Ideal for small projects, specific tasks, or when you need rapid changes for well -defined tasks. They offer flexibility and competitive prices, but long -term support and frequent accessibility can be an idea.
Agencies: A complete team, best suited for complex projects that require extensive project management and underlying quality assurance procedures. They usually come with a prize, but give a more structured approach.
Offshore Teams:A very popular choice to achieve cost-effectiveness and access a large global talent pool. It may include dedicated teams from areas known for strong technical talents such as India.
Why Many Businesses Hire Laravel Developers in India
Many companies choose to hire Laravel developers in India because of the country's talented, English -speaking developers and sufficient pools with very competitive prices. Indian Laravel developers regularly have widespread experiences in one-of-a-kind industries and are professional in running with international customers, making them a strategic alternative for outsourcing.
Benefits of Hiring Offshore Laravel Developers
Hiring an offshore Laravel developer or dedicated team provides many compelling benefits:
Cost-Effectiveness: Significant cost savings compared to employment in areas with high life costs often reduce growth expenses by a sufficient margin.
Access to Global Talent: Take advantage of a wide talent pool so you can find very specific developers with niche skills that can be locally rare.
Time Zone Advantages: Can enable development around the clock, where the work continues even after the local team's commercial hours potentially accelerates the project.
Scalability and Flexibility: Local employment -affiliated complications and the needs of ups and downs without overhead give the agility to easily score your team up or down.
Evaluate Technical Skills and Experience
When you set out to hire Laravel developers, consider their skills well in the following areas:
PHP and Laravel Framework: PHP Fundamental, Object-Oriented Programming (OOP) The deep understanding of the principles, and specialized in the main components of the laravel
MVC Architecture:A sturdy grasp of the Model-View-Controller layout sample and a way to correctly enforce it within Laravel.
Database Management: Extensive revel in relational databases like MySQL, PostgreSQL, and potentially NoSQL databases like MongoDB, consisting of database design, optimization, and query writing.
RESTful APIs: The capability to layout, construct, and devour RESTful APIs for seamless records exchange and integration with different systems.
Version Control:Proficiency with Git and collaborative structures which include GitHub, GitLab, or Bitbucket.
Front-end Technologies: Familiarity with HTML, CSS, JavaScript, and preferably revel in with present day JavaScript frameworks like Vue.Js (Laravel's default front-stop framework), React, or Angular.
Testing: Experience with PHPUnit for unit and characteristic checking out, and a commitment to writing testable code.
Conduct Technical Interviews and Code Assessments
In addition to reviewing the CV, the operation of complete technical evaluation of the laravel importance is:
Technical Interviews: Ask questions that examine their understanding of Laravel concepts, their attitude to problems and specific experiences from previous projects. Ask about their knowledge of newer largest updates and trends (eg largest octane, live wire).
Code Assessments/Live Coding: Provide a practical coding challenge or a small home project. This allows you to evaluate their actual coding skills, best practice, code quality and ability to meet specified requirements.
Portfolio Review: Carefully examine their previous work. Look for different projects that demonstrate their ability to handle complexity, create scalable applications and integrate different systems.
Where to Find and Hire Laravel Developers
Top Platforms to Hire Laravel Developers
Freelance Platforms: Popular options include Upwork, Fiver and Top tier (top-races known for their hard Beating process).
Job Boards: LinkedIn, General Job Tablets such as Real and Glassdoor, and professional network pages as a specialized technical job board.
Developer Communities: Github, Stack Overflow and Laravel Specific Forums (e.g. Laravel.io, Laracasts) can be an excellent source for finding the developers active and experts on platforms such as Laravel.io, Laracasts.
Specialized Agencies: recruitment agencies or development companies that are experts in larva development and growth of employees can provide talent before reviewing and extensive recruitment solutions.
Should You Hire Laravel Developers in India?
Yes, hiring Laravel developers in India is a very viable and often beneficial alternative for businesses. India provides a strong balance between cost -effectiveness and quality. The country's strong IT education system produces a large number of talented people, many of whom have experience working with international customers and understanding the method of the global project. In addition, many Indian development companies offer extensive services including project management and quality assurance.
Pros and Cons of Hiring Through Freelance Platforms
Pros:
Cost-Effective: Often cheaper than attractive agencies that create their own employment.
Flexibility: For quick -time period initiatives or specific responsibilities, clean agility to scale your group provides up or down.
Diverse Talent Pool: Access to a wide variety of developers with exceptional understanding and global approach..
Cons:
Less Control: Internal teams or dedicated agency models can pay less direct inspection and dedicated attention.
Communication Challenges:The difference and relevant language barriers in the field require potential, active management.
Commitment Issues:Freelancers can control several projects at the identical time, that may potentially affect their committed attention in your project.
Long-Term Support: Securing consistent prolonged-time period manual or ongoing preservation from man or woman freelancers can sometimes be challenging.
Key Skills to Look for in a Laravel Developer
Must-Have Technical Skills (PHP, Laravel, MVC, APIs)
As highlighted, middle technical skills are foundational. Ensure applicants demonstrate robust proficiency in:
PHP: A thorough facts of present day PHP versions, together with object-oriented programming (OOP), design styles, and outstanding practices.
Laravel Framework: Expertise in all components of the Laravel framework, which incorporates routing, controllers, Eloquent ORM, migrations, queues, middleware, broadcasting, and Blade templating.
MVC Architecture: The potential to efficiently form packages adhering to the Model-View-Controller layout pattern for maintainability and scalability.
APIs: Extensive experience in each building sturdy RESTful APIs and integrating with third-party APIs. Familiarity with GraphQL can be a significant plus.
Database Knowledge: Strong command of SQL, database layout principles, question optimization, and enjoyment with applicable database structures.
Front-end Integration: Competence in integrating Laravel with the front-give up generation and JavaScript frameworks, in particular Vue.Js or Livewire.
Soft Skills: Communication, Collaboration, and Problem-Solving
Technical prowess is vital, but gentle capabilities are similarly essential for group concord and project success. Look for:
Communication: Clear, concise, and effective verbal and written communication talents. This is especially important when you lease offshore Laravel developer groups to bridge geographical distances..
Collaboration: The skills to seamlessly interior a team's environment, make use of collaborative equipment (e.G., Jira, Trello, Slack), and actively participate in code reviews.
Problem-Solving:Strong analytical abilities to speedy understand complicated troubles, debug efficiently, and devise revolutionary, efficient answers.
Adaptability: Openness to mastering the new generation, adopting evolving satisfactory practices, and adapting to adjustments in venture necessities or priorities.
Industry Experience and Portfolio Evaluation
Relevant Industry Experience: Assess if the developer has prior experience running on tasks much like yours or within your specific enterprise area. This can frequently translate to a quicker expertise of enterprise needs and commonplace demanding situations.
Portfolio: A nicely-curated portfolio showcasing diverse tasks, clean code, and a successful real-global implementation is a robust indicator of a developer's talents. Pay attention to the complexity of the projects, their function in every, and how they contributed to the answer.
Cost of Hiring Laravel Developers
Global Laravel Developer Rates
The fee to hire Laravel developers varies appreciably based totally totally on factors at the side of vicinity, stage of experience, and the selected engagement version (freelancer, agency, or dedicated team). As of 2025:
North America/Western Europe: Typically the best fees, starting from $70-$100 fifty in line with hours for mid to senior-stage developers.
Eastern Europe: Mid-variety costs, regularly among $30-$60 per hour.
South Asia (e.g., India): Generally the maximum value-effective, with fees from $15-$forty in line with an hour for experienced skills. It's crucial to note that senior developers and people with relatively specialised abilities (e.G., DevOps for Laravel, AI/ML integration) will command better quotes irrespective of vicinity.
Why Hiring Laravel Developers in India Is Cost-Effective
When you choose to hire Laravel developer in India, you can comprehend sizable fee financial savings without always compromising on satisfaction. The lower price of residing and operational expenses in India without delay translate to extra aggressive hourly or challenge quotes. Despite the decreased value, India possesses a big and growing pool of exceptionally skilled Laravel professionals with strong technical backgrounds and massive revel in working with diverse global clients.
How to Balance Budget and Quality When Hiring Offshore
To correctly balance cost and exceptional while you hire offshore Laravel developer teams:
Clear and Detailed Requirements: Well-described undertaking necessities and popularity standards save you scope creep and make sure the offshore group grants exactly what is wanted, minimizing rework.
Thorough Vetting Process: Do not pass comprehensive technical assessments, more than one rounds of interviews, and rigorous portfolio reviews, even if thinking about price-effective offshore options.
Start Small with a Pilot Project:Consider beginning a smaller, nicely-scoped trial assignment to evaluate the group's capabilities, communique effectiveness, and usual health before dedicating Laravel , lengthy-term engagement.
Look for Transparency: Partner with carriers who provide transparent pricing fashions, provide ordinary development updates, and maintain clean, proactive verbal exchange channels in the course of the project lifecycle.
Best Practices to Hire Laravel Developers Successfully
Write a Clear Job Description
A precise, specific, and attractive process description is crucial for attracting the proper candidates. Ensure it sincerely specifies:
Role and Responsibilities: Define the everyday responsibilities and prevalent expectancies for the position.
Required Skills: List each the critical technical abilities and ideal tender skills.
Project Details: Briefly describe the type of initiatives the developer can be working on and the commercial enterprise impact.
Compensation and Benefits:Outline the revenue range, any perks, and the running model (e.G., faraway, hybrid, in-workplace, contract).
Use Technical Assessments and Trial Tasks
As previously emphasised, sensible assessments are crucial for validating a candidate's talents. Beyond theoretical expertise, technical tests or small trial responsibilities show a developer's capability to jot down easy, efficient, nicely-examined, and maintainable code in a real-international situation. This also allows checking their hassle-fixing technique and adherence to coding standards.
Protect Your IP with Contracts and NDAs
Safeguarding your highbrow assets (IP) and touchy enterprise records is paramount. Implement robust felony files such as:
Non-Disclosure Agreements (NDAs): Ensure the confidentiality of proprietary statistics, exchange secrets, and venture information.
Intellectual Property Assignment Agreements:Clearly outline the ownership of all code, designs, and some other property advanced in the course of the engagement. These felony protections are particularly important while you lease offshore Laravel builders or have interaction with freelancers.
Foster Long-Term Relationships with Talented Developers
Building enduring relationships with your Laravel developers, whether they're in-residence or outsourced, yields sizable blessings. Provide opportunities for professional increase, provide truthful and competitive compensation, and cultivate a supportive and collaborative working environment. Engaged and valued developers are much more likely to supply first-rate paintings, remain devoted to your initiatives, and become useful long-time period assets for your enterprise.
Common Mistakes to Avoid When You Hire a Laravel Developer
Ignoring Communication Skills
A frequent pitfall is focusing entirely on a candidate's technical competencies even as overlooking their communication skills. Poor conversation can result in commonplace misunderstandings, assignment delays, rework, and a miles less efficient and collaborative group surroundings, regardless of how technically talented a developer can be. Always verify their capacity to articulate ideas really, ask pertinent questions, and provide positive comments.
Focusing Only on Cost
While price-effectiveness is a considerable benefit, mainly when you recall alternatives to hire Laravel developers in India, creating a hiring choice based entirely on the bottom rate can frequently show to be a false economic system. Extremely low quotes may indicate compromised excellent, overlooked closing dates, a loss of enjoyment, or insufficient guidance, doubtlessly costing you extra in terms of misplaced time, transform, and in the long run, a subpar product. Prioritize typical cost, verified understanding, and reliability over more price.
Skipping Background or Code Quality Checks
Never bypass vital due diligence. Always affirm references, thoroughly review past projects, and conduct rigorous code nice checks on sample paintings or in the course of technical tests.This allows verifying a developer's claimed capabilities, guarantees their adherence to enterprise nice practices, and minimizes the threat of collecting technical debt for your project, which may be high-priced to rectify later.
Final Thoughts: Making the Right Hire for Your Laravel Project
Hiring the right Laravel developer or development team is a strategic decision that can determine the depth of success and the path of your web project. By understanding the strong characteristics of the largest, carefully defined the specific needs of your project, and following a structured and comprehensive recruitment process, you can safely identify and on board talented individuals who will bring your vision to the fruit. Whether you choose to hireLaravel developers locally, associate with a particular agency, or strategically, choose us for the hiring offshore Laravel development teams for cost-willing and access to various global talents, a thoughtful and hard-working attitude will ensure you make the optimal hire for your Laravel project.
Subscribe to my newsletter
Read articles from AIS technolabs directly inside your inbox. Subscribe to the newsletter, and don't miss out.
Written by
